Unlike the National Electrical Code (NEC/NFPA 70), which dictates how electrical installations must be performed in the field, UL 508A dictates how the panel must be built in the factory. Compliance with UL 508A allows a manufacturer to apply a UL Listing mark to their panel, which is often a prerequisite for installation in commercial and industrial settings in the United States and Canada.
